What do Universal Precautions (UP) require from employers and employees?

Explanation:
Universal Precautions (UP) are a set of guidelines that aim to prevent the transmission of infectious diseases in healthcare settings. The core principle of Universal Precautions is to treat all human blood and body fluids as if they are potentially infectious, regardless of the perceived risk associated with a particular situation or individual. This approach emphasizes the importance of taking appropriate precautions when handling blood and body fluids to protect both employees and patients from the risk of infection. By assuming that all human blood and body fluids are infectious, healthcare professionals can consistently implement protective measures—such as wearing gloves, masks, and eye protection—while performing their duties. This not only enhances the safety of healthcare workers but also creates a safer environment for patients. The other options do not align with the essential principles of Universal Precautions. Assuming materials are harmless disregards the potential risks posed by infectious agents. Practicing only in clinical environments limits the scope of precautions needed, as exposure can occur in various settings including residential care facilities. Performing tests on all biological samples could be logistically challenging and unnecessary, as the focus is on safe practices rather than testing every sample. Thus, the requirement to assume all human blood and body fluids are infectious is central to ensuring safety in all healthcare environments.

Exam Format

The Residential Care and Assisted Living Administrator Exam is structured to test the comprehensive knowledge of potential administrators. It features a series of multiple-choice questions designed to reflect real-world scenarios and administration challenges. Typically, the exam consists of several sections, each focusing on key aspects of RCAL management:

  • General Knowledge: Covering the overall understanding of RCAL environments, industry standards, and ethical considerations.
  • Legal and Regulatory Framework: Questions explore state-specific laws and federal regulations.
  • Resident Care and Quality Management: Focuses on principles of care, safety protocols, and quality improvement strategies.
  • Financial Management: Includes budget planning, financial oversight, and resource allocation.
  • Human Resources: Evaluates understanding of staff management, training needs, and compliance with labor laws.

The exam may consist of 100 questions with a combination of case studies and theoretical queries. The pass mark usually requires scoring at least 70%.

What is the salary range for an RCAL Administrator in the United States?

In the United States, the salary for a Residential Care and Assisted Living Administrator can range from $50,000 to over $90,000 annually, depending on experience, location, and the size of the facility. This role is crucial in ensuring high-quality care for residents, making it both rewarding and competitive.

Are there any prerequisites for taking the RCAL Administrator exam?

Yes, most states require candidates to complete a specific number of training hours and coursework related to assisted living and care administration before qualifying for the RCAL Administrator exam. Check local requirements to ensure you complete the necessary steps before applying.

Is the RCAL Administrator exam conducted in person or online?

The RCAL Administrator exam is typically conducted in person at designated testing centers. However, some states may offer online options under specific circumstances. Always check with your state’s licensing board for the latest information on exam formats and availability.
